Frequently Asked Questions about Studio Huntington Park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Huntington Park with Studio?

Currently the most affordable Studio in Huntington Park is at 7113 Stafford Ave listed at $850.

How much is the average rent for a Studio Huntington Park Apartment?

The average rent for a Studio Apartment in Huntington Park is $2,883.

What is the largest available Studio Huntington Park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Huntington Park is a 1,125 square feet unit starting from $2,650 at Santa Fe Art Colony.

What is the average size for Huntington Park Studio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Studio rental in Huntington Park is currently 500 sq ft.
